SMP 228: After the Big Beautiful Bill: What’s Next for US Residential Solar?

Episode Summary: Benoy Thanjan sits down with his co-host Nate Jovanelly, Founder & CEO of SunRaise Capital, to break down how the Big Beautiful Bill is reshaping residential solar. They discuss Section 25D’s removal, the surge in solar + storage, and innovative financing models like prepaid leases.   Biographies Benoy Thanjan Benoy Thanjan is the Founder and CEO of Reneu Energy, and a strategic advisor to multiple solar startups. SMP 226: Solar, Storage, and Strategy: How Catalyst Power Is Transforming C&I Energy

Episode Overview In this episode, Benoy Thanjan interviews Gabe Phillips, CEO of Catalyst Power Holdings, a company revolutionizing how commercial and industrial (C&I) customers access clean energy.  The conversation dives into the future of C&I solar, energy storage, demand response, and how Catalyst Power is empowering mid-sized businesses with creative, cost-saving clean energy solutions. Topics Covered: * Gabe's background and evolution in the energy sector * The unique C&I clean energy niche Catalyst Power serves * The role of DERs (distributed energy resources) and why aggregation matters * Combining solar, storage, and demand response into a single value proposition * The importance of customer acquisition and tech-enabled platforms * Opportunities and challenges in Northeast markets like NYISO and PJM * What’s next for C&I energy solutions as federal and state incentives evolve Key Quotes: “We’re focused on the forgotten middle — C&I customers that are too big for rooftop-only and too small for full-blown utility-scale.” “There’s a convergence of tech and finance in clean energy that’s finally unlocking the C&I market.” “We’re not just selling power — we’re building long-term energy partnerships.”   Benoy Thanjan Benoy Thanjan is the Founder and CEO of Reneu Energy and he is also an advisor for several solar startup companies.  He has extensive project origination, development, and financial experience in the renewable energy industry and in the environmental commodities market.   This includes initial site evaluation, permitting, financing, sourcing equipment, and negotiating the long-term energy and environmental commodities off-take agreements. SMP 224: How REC Solar Is Navigating Market Uncertainty, Load Growth, and the Next Wave of Solar Innovation

Episode Overview In this episode of the Solar Maverick Podcast, Benoy Thanjan speaks with Robb Jetty, CEO of REC Solar.  Rob shares insights from his 23-year journey in renewable energy, REC’s behind-the-meter and utility-scale development strategy, and the company’s active role in greenfield projects, energy storage, and asset repowering. SMP 223: Farming the Sun: How Agrivoltaics is Transforming Energy and Agriculture

Episode Overview Benoy Thanjan welcomes back Dan French, Executive Producer of the Solar Farm Summit on the Solar Maverick Podcast and they dive deep into the emerging world of agrivoltaics—solar projects that co-exist with agriculture—and the role it will play in the energy and agricultural renaissance. Dan shares details about the upcoming Solar Farm Summit (Aug 4–7 at McCormick Place, Chicago), the largest agrivoltaics event in North America. They explore U.S. state-level leadership, global innovation, project economics, and transformative benefits such as water conservation, improved crop yields, and rural revitalization.
